Crower Stage 1 Feedback Please

I am have been looking for some personal feedback/experience with the crower stage 1 cam. I have been searching this forum and others and everything on about the stage 2 or 3 or why you should just buy the stage 2 or 3. Well Im not interested in the stage 2 or 3 cam.
I am look to hear from anyone who had the stage 1, any positive or negative feedback, their thoughts on its performance gains, difference in the feel of driving, and what other bolt ons you have on your car.
I have a 01 EX so the D17A2, anyone that also had the same, feedback from you would be awesome.

Re: Crower Stage 1 Feedback Please

There's a dude on "the other forum" that was making 124.5 whp with an automatic D17A1 with an A2 head, Crower Stage 1 cam, I/H/E, and no tune. Could probably squeeze another 5-10 whp with proper tuning. I think this is gonna be my next mod, assuming I gets monies.

Re: Crower Stage 1 Feedback Please

I believe I saw cheap cams on weaksauceparts.com

I say don't go for any brand that classifies their parts with a "stage". Learn the right duration for your application. I am saying this because those companies often charge more for a larger duration cam that costs them the same to produce as a small duration cam.

I believe Brian Crower makes many cams with lots of different durations, even a big 310!

Re: Crower Stage 1 Feedback Please

Originally Posted by xRiCeBoYx
There's a dude on "the other forum" that was making 124.5 whp with an automatic D17A1 with an A2 head, Crower Stage 1 cam, I/H/E, and no tune. Could probably squeeze another 5-10 whp with proper tuning. I think this is gonna be my next mod, assuming I gets monies.
yup, bomerman19, he is around here sometimes too.
i guess that is the tops anyone would be able to squeezee out from the D17's.
worth it, from what i hear.
the stage 3 would require springs and retainers and a hondata, so not interesting money wise.
There was one guy asking about the OBX or similar, but i hear they have some issues, so the crower stage 1 seems to be best option, especially if you can get one used.

Re: Crower Stage 1 Feedback Please

I have the stage 1 crower cam, the civic def. feels more peppy... 7-10WHP is avg HP from the stage 1. I have that and then whats in my sig, also an organic clutch (exedy) and a Exedy LW 11.6lb flywheel. gotta find my dyno sheet because saying i have 150 something to the wheels is just like dust in the air (lol) but thats all on 91 pump gas. the downside to performance parts is sacrifice gas mileage with HP/TQ... i get around 30 highway and 27 city on 91
